Baronscourt Lakes - Coarse Angling |
 |
 |
|
|
Description of Water: There are three coarse angling lakes within the Baronscourt Estate, Lough Catherine, Lough Fanny and Lough Mary which are all interconnected.
The best time of year to fish is between April and October. The lakes are in pristine condition and are fished on regularly. |
| Nearest Town/Village: Newtownstewart |
| How to get there: Follow signs for Newtownstewart
(A5). Travelling from the South take the second exit sign for
Newtownstewart and at the miniroundabout
bear right onto the
Strabane Road. After passing a Spar
shop on the right, approx. 150m after
this the main road veers to the right
with a fork road to the left.
Take this fork road signed Baronscourt
and Drumquin (B84).Continue along
the B84 for approx. 4 miles and turn
right at a cream coloured Gate Lodge
and proceed to the Estate Office. |
| Day Ticket Outlets: Pike fishing is available to fishermen staying in the self-catering accommodation on Baronscourt Estate. |
| Area: Newtownstewart
Co Tyrone. |
| Species: Pike |
| Season: All year |
| Boats: Available for hire |
| Methods: All legal methods
permitted. |
| Licence: Loughs Agency,
Tel: 028 7134 2100 |
| Permit: Abercorn Estates,
Baronscourt,
Newtownstewart.
Tel 028 8166 1683 |
| Size Limit: 25.4cm (10ins) Min |
